I figured I'd just throw this out there and ask since everything just kept coming up "Silkie" and I know its not, it really looks nothing like the one I have. Anyways. We ended up picking up a couple chicks yesterday at a feedstore. I haven't gotten around to taking a picture yet- but they have greyish/blue fuzz, grey/blue skin and beak, 4 toes, what appears to be a single comb, feathered legs, and beards. I'm thinking Blue D'uccles? I will post pics later.
